The ITC-312 Bluetooth Smart Temperature Controller has three control functions--general
temperature mode, day/night mode, and time mode, and supports two setting methods--range
method and return differential method, making it more flexible to use. Users can choose the
setting method according to their usage habits. At the same time, it supports a Bluetooth
function, which enables app operation, which is more convenient. The device can store 30
days of temperature history and the phone app can store up to 1 year of temperature data.
It also has high and low-temperature alarm functions and is an intelligent controller that is
widely used for heating, cultivation, seedling growing, wood sheds, home living, and more.

4.1 Setting Guideline
Select the device setting method through the App: Temperature range setting mode or
Temperature return difference setting mode.
04
Operation Instructions
08

Temperature range setting mode: Separately set start and stop temperatures for heating
and cooling devices. (Recommended)
Temperature return difference setting mode: Set the target temperature and the return
difference value of heating and cooling temperatures. (Select this method if you are more
accustomed to the setting logic of the ITC-308.)
4.2 Running Mode Guideline
Select the device operating mode through the App: Temperature mode (default), Day/Night
mode, or Time mode.
Temperature Mode: Power on or off the plug-in devices according to the current
temperature and target temperature.
Day/Night Mode: 2 target temperatures can be set in a day, and the controller
will perform different temperature controls according to the 2 preset control periods.
Time Mode: Up to 12 target temperatures can be set in a day, and the controller will
perform different temperature controls according to the preset time periods.

4.4.2 Temperature Return Difference Setting Mode
Press the knob button to enter the quick setting of target temperature. The screen will display
the character and the start heating temperature, with the latter flashing. Turn the knob
button to adjust the parameter, then press the knob button to confirm and switch to the setting
of heating differential value ( ) and cooling differential value ( ). If there is no operation
within 10 seconds, the device will automatically exit quick setting, or, when is displayed,
press the knob button again to exit the setting.

Cleaning and Maintenance
07
Important Notes/Warnings
6.1 Please make sure to unplug the temperature controller before cleaning. If cleaning
is necessary, use a dry, clean cloth to wipe it; do not clean with water or a wet cloth.
6.2 Do not place it where children can touch it. Store in a dry, ventilated place.
7.1 KEEP CHILDREN AWAY.
7.2 USE INDOORS ONLY TO REDUCE THE RISK OF ELECTRIC SHOCK.
7.3 DO NOT CONNECT TO OTHER RELOCATABLE POWER SOURCES OR EXTENSION
CORDS.
7.4 USE IN A DRY PLACE ONLY.
7.5 DO NOT PLACE NEAR WATER TO REDUCE THE RISK OF ELECTRIC SHOCK.
7.6 DO NOT EXPOSE TO HIGH TEMPERATURES.
7.7 THE HOUSING OF THE TEMPERATURE PROBE IS MADE OF STAINLESS STEEL
MATERIALS. WIPE OFF ANY STAINS TO AVOID AFFECTING THE ACCURACY OR RESPONSE
TIME OF THE PROBE.
7.8 DO NOT CONNECT IT TO A PRODUCT THAT IS NOT RATED FOR ITS VOLTAGE, WHICH
MAY CAUSE FIRE HAZARDS.
